Mr. Brewer was born February 20th, 1944 in Barberton, OH to his late parents Beacher Haywood Brewer and Violet Mae Proctor Brewer. He was a Manatee High School graduate, 1962
Bradenton, FL, served honorably in the United States Army during Vietnam and attended Tampa Tech where he received his associate degree. Charles worked for GTE Corporation for 27 years and was a member of Cherry Log Christian Church.
He is survived by his wife of 44 years, Shirley A. Parks Brewer of the home in Cherry Log, GA; brother and sister-in-law, Larry and Jean Brewer of Lake City, FL and niece Sandra Jean Matthews, of Naples, FL; sister-in-law, Florence Steel and niece Marianne Loseke of Wildwood, MO and nephews, James Steel of Washington, NC, David Steel and Gary Steel of Ames, IA and Eunice and Chuck Griswold of Ft. Myers, FL and niece Christina Griswold, Boynton Beach, FL and nephew Charles Griswold of Cape Coral, FL; niece Debra Rusek of Palmetto, FL and nephew Douglas Tyler of Roswell, GA; numerous great nieces and great nephews also survive.
